Cabinet Staining Service Questions
What is cabinet staining? Cabinet staining involves applying a transparent or semi-transparent color to enhance or change the appearance of existing cabinets without replacing them.
Can staining update the look of old cabinets? Yes, staining can refresh worn or outdated cabinets, providing a new style while preserving the existing structure.
What types of finishes are available for cabinet staining? Finishes range from matte to glossy, with options for different levels of sheen to match interior decor preferences.
Is staining suitable for all cabinet materials? Staining works best on wood surfaces and may not be suitable for laminated or painted cabinets without additional preparation.
